Taxpayers can elect to claim “exempt” from taxes if they had a right to all of the money they paid in via federal tax the previous y...Jan 26, 2022 · While nonprofit status is granted by the state, tax-exemption status must be applied for through the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). If an application is approved, the organization will receive a ruling in the form of a letter that clarifies the exemption. To file for 501 (c) (3) tax-exempt status, a nonprofit must complete the IRS form 1023. Federal law governs tax-exempt status. The Internal Revenue Code specifically refers to exemption from federal income tax. Nonprofit status may make an organization eligible for certain benefits, such as state sales, property and income tax exemptions. Not all nonprofit organizations qualify for a property tax exemption. Those that may be eligible are authorized by RCW chapter 84.36 and WAC chapter 458‐16. In 2022, the department processed almost 600 new applications from nonprofit organizations seeking exemption from property tax.... tax deductible. Form 1023 is the IRS form used for your organization to apply for income tax-exempt status. The Form 1023 is complex and you should seek the assistance of an attorney or tax professional to complete it. You can find more information on Form 1023 from the IRS website. To be exempt under Internal Revenue Code (IRC) section 501 (c) (8), a fraternal beneficiary society, order, or association must meet the following requirements: It must have a fraternal purpose. Most not-for-profits that fail to file Form 990 for three consecutive years will have their exempt status revoked automatically.
